Title :
Matching fibres for low loss coupling into fibre amplifiers

Abstract :
Fibre amplifier gain may be greatly increased by reducing the field spot size. However, the resulting mismatch between the fields in the amplifier and standard fibre leads to large splicing losses which reduce the amplifier efficiency. The authors show theoretically that total splice loss may be greatly reduced by using one or more intermediate fibres.
